Finding GCD of 653, 698, 450, 419 using Prime Factorization

Given Input Data is 653, 698, 450, 419

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ially

Prime Factorization of 653 is 653

Prime Factorization of 698 is 2 x 349

Prime Factorization of 450 is 2 x 3 x 3 x 5 x 5

Prime Factorization of 419 is 419

The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
